A History Of Evil

A sequel to 2014 horror game ‘The Evil Within’,will launch October 13 for P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C, Bethesda announced during its E3 press conference. The hit horror game from  Resident Evil creator Shinji Mikami will simply be called ‘The Evil Within 2’.

The game will be continuing the adventure of Sebastian Castellanos, protagonist of The Evil Within. It has been confirmed that the story will be set three years after the events of the first game. There will be direct links between the story from the first game with Sebastian having to re-enter STEMS to save his daughter. The trailer shows a good mix of stealth and gun combat – staples of the first game.

Details are still scarce as to any player upgrades, however, the game play trailer shows sharper graphics than it’s predecessor. The teaser also shows smoother player movements and of course blood, gore and monsters. Lots and lots of monsters. The official site for the game teases;

  • Story of Redemption – Return to the nightmare to win back your life and the ones you love.
  • Discover Horrifying Domains – Explore as far or quickly as you dare, but prepare wisely.
  • Face Disturbing Enemies – Survive the onslaught of horrifying creatures determined to rip you apart.
  • Choose How to Survive – Craft traps, sneak, run and hide, or try to battle the horror with limited ammo.
  • Visceral Horror and Suspense – Enter a frightening world filled with anxiety-inducing thrills and disturbing moments.

As both the teaser and trailer show – while ammo might be in short supply – the horror certainly wont.
